After completing his medical studies at the University of Buenos Aires, Guevara became politically active first in his native Argentina and then in neighboring Bolivia and Guatemala. He served as a military advisor to Castro and led guerrilla troops in battles against Batista forces. Guevara addressed the United Nations General Assembly on December 11, , where he also expressed support for the people of Puerto Rico.
One year later, he was appointed minister of industry. In , he began to try to incite the people of Bolivia to rebel against their government, but had little success. With only a small guerrilla force to support his efforts, Guevara was captured and killed on October 9, in La Higuera by the Bolivian army, which had been aided by CIA advisers. Since his death, Guevara has become a legendary political figure. His name is often equated with rebellion, revolution, and socialism.
Others, however, have remembered that he could be ruthless and ordered prisoners executed without trial in Cuba.
